datoviz::high_voltage:使用Vulkan实现高性能GPU交互式科学数据可视化 源码
达托维兹(Datoviz):借助Vulkan实现GPU交互式科学数据可视化 Datoviz是一个开源高性能交互式科学数据可视化库,利用图形处理单元( GPU )来提高速度,视觉质量和可伸缩性。 它支持2D和3D渲染,以及最少的图形用户界面(使用)。 Datoviz用C语言编写,是从头开始设计的,旨在提高性能。 它提供了本机Python绑定(基于Cython)。 由于社区的努力(Julia,R,MATLAB,Rust,C#等),可以开发与其他语言的绑定。 达托维兹使用由OpenGL的后继者Khronos联盟创建的 。 支持其他现代图形API,例如WebGPU,将构成有趣的发展。 达托维兹目前主要由(由全球神经科学研究实验室组成的财团)的开发。 达托维兹正处于发展初期。 该库非常有用,但是发展很快。 Datoviz已在Linux,macOS(英特尔)和较小程度上的Windows上进行了测
文件列表
datoviz::high_voltage:使用Vulkan实现高性能GPU交互式科学数据可视化
(预估有个251文件)
triangle.c
680KB
colorspace.c
37KB
ansicolor-w32.c
12KB
setup-env.bat
86B
transfers.c
16KB
visuals.c
26KB
context.c
23KB
scene.c
12KB
graphics.c
29KB
mesh.c
17KB
暂无评论